Another Tough Away Fixture

After our defeat against Manchester City, ending our eight-game unbeaten run, our next game is away again, this time the Cherries travel to Villa Park to play Aston Villa on Sunday at 2 pm. Andoni Iraola faces a fellow Spaniard for the second game in a row in Unai Emery. Last game before the international break, and it is again on Sky.

Since Unai Emery’s two full seasons in charge of Aston Villa, this season in their opening five games have been the poorest. Villa were sitting in 18th place with 3 points, having drawn 3 and lost 2 games. Now, after ten games, they are in 11th position with 15 points, having won 4 and lost 1 in their last five games.
